Output 8e96ae46a3c985b3075f01b892b52ddcff4dcf2dfae1fd3eaa4ab8ee27410137:0

value
356171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f6704f2a03cb3c29e52b185d7463f4b77833be7 OP_EQUAL
address
34Z4HQ5wHeyuGJi5VqZgrbX7V9kvtKg6Gg
transaction
8e96ae46a3c985b3075f01b892b52ddcff4dcf2dfae1fd3eaa4ab8ee27410137
confirmations
137545
spent
true